Съдържание[Крия][Покажи]
Бизнес изискванията за нови приложения и услуги се разшириха драстично през последните години, което наложи необходимостта от ускоряване на процеса на разработка на приложения.
Освен това процесът на развитие се разви драматично. Разработката е бърз процес, който изисква чести надстройки на програмата, корекции, подобрения и т.н. Тези модификации изискват среди за разработка, осигуряване на качеството, непрекъснато внедряване, инфраструктура и т.н.
Това е мястото, където EaaS влиза в действие. EaaS (Среда като услуга) предоставя среди като услуга, позволявайки ви да управлявате всичките си среди ефективно и бързо, без усилие.
Тази публикация ще разгледа околната среда като услуга, ползите от нея, защо се нуждаем от нея, как влияе на DevOps и много повече.
И така, какво е околната среда като услуга?
Околната среда като услуга облекчава притесненията относно администрирането и управлението на облачните решения, като предоставя пълно управление на бизнес процесите от край до край, което позволява на организациите да получат контрол върху своите операции.
EaaS процедурите са предназначени основно за справяне с бизнес предизвикателствата на организацията и управлението на процеси.
Партньорските фирми също могат да си сътрудничат, за да извършват сравними и поддържащи бизнес операции, благодарение на достъпа и гъвкавостта на облачните изчисления в световен мащаб.
Това е естествено продължение на инфраструктурата като услуга (IaaS). Въпреки това, в допълнение към конвенционалния хардуер и основен софтуер, EaaS съдържа целия ви код и настройки, както и инфраструктурата и инструментите за работа с вашето приложение в изолирана среда.
Автоматизацията се използва за извършване на сървърна конфигурация за определени приложения в EaaS, тъй като това е услуга, при която приложението и средата се изпълняват едновременно, докато са обект на контрол на версията.
Платформата EaaS ефективно се грижи за останалото, когато обяснявате приложението си на системата. Тъй като е всеобхватна среда за приложения, той предлага и фантастична среда за тестване.
Защо организациите се нуждаят от околната среда като услуга?
Когато разработват нов продукт или услуга, екипите трябва да тестват целия свързан код, за да се уверят, че е функционален, сигурен и без грешки. Тази процедура изисква различни ситуации. Екипите работят в единна, споделена сцена, но в много случаи.
Разработчиците трябва да се наредят на опашка, за да тестват своя компонент от продукта поради тази конфигурация. Сред основните причини за забавяне на доставката са тези ограничения.
Средите като услуга (EaaS) адресират тези проблеми, като предоставят на бизнес единиците достъп до каталог от пълни среди на приложения, които включват необходимите инфраструктурни части, разрешения и логика за оркестрация.
Тези среди могат да бъдат достъпни чрез портал за самообслужване или, ако помагате на екипи на DevOps, като използвате индивидуалните CLI или IDE инструменти на екипите.
Средите се предоставят, внедряват и координират в рамките на минути благодарение на конфигурацията на чертежите и се извеждат от експлоатация автоматично в края на всяка сесия.
Освен това дизайнерите на планове могат да се уверят, че всеки план се придържа към изискванията за съответствие на организацията и включва правилните процеси за сигурност.
В допълнение към елиминирането на точките на затруднения, средите като услуга намаляват възможността за човешки грешки.
Това дава възможност на предприятията да обменят части за многократна употреба и намалява възможността те да разработят ИТ инфраструктури, спестявайки им време и пари.
Предимства на EaaS
Въпреки факта, че много компании могат да извършат тези дейности, използвайки местни ресурси, те все пак решават да инвестират в EaaS поради следните причини:
- EaaS намалява разходите за поддръжка и поддръжка на някои приложения.
- Потребителите получават по-бърз достъп до крайния резултат, което подобрява мнението им за вашето приложение.
- Намаляването на неизползваните инструменти води до по-ефективно използване на ресурсите.
- Това ви позволява повече свобода да променяте приложението си в бъдеще.
- По-ниските времена на проектния цикъл водят до по-ранни дати за пускане на софтуерните функции.
- Това е досаден и предизвикателен за мащабиране процес за екипите на DevOps за изграждане на среди за приложения, които позволяват тестване, бързо развитие и внедряване. Вместо това EaaS ви дава възможност да получите среди, което улеснява разрастването на вашето приложение.
Случаи на използване на EaaS
Среда за тестване
Средата за тестване е доста специфична и включва настройка на място за извършване на тестване на компонентни части. Оборудването и софтуерът, които използвате за провеждане на теста, са включени.
Вие конструирате и създавате този вид среда, за да тествате дадена функция по определен начин. Всеки обект, който създавате, независимо дали е приложение или компонент, има предпоставки, които трябва да бъдат изпълнени за тестване.
Следователно, вместо средата да диктува вашия тестван компонент, вярно е обратното.
Тестова среда за миграция
Като стартиращ или развиващ се бизнес почти определено ще трябва да управлявате миграциите в даден момент. Фазите на миграция могат да причинят психични проблеми.
Преди да преминете към производство, можете да тествате миграции, като използвате среда, подобна на производствената (включително данни), за да сте сигурни, че всичко ще функционира според очакванията.
Сценична среда
Сценичната среда е конфигурирана да изглежда точно като вашата производствена среда. Няма разграничение между сценарийната среда и вашия завършен продукт.
Можете да го считате за защитена зона, където можете да сглобите всичко, за да научите как функционира, защото е точно възпроизвеждане на вашия продукт. По същество това е върхът на тестовете за осигуряване на качество, който ви позволява да симулирате реалното нещо възможно най-близо.
Демонстрационна среда за продажби
Представете си, че трябва бързо да стартирате сървър и да създадете демонстрационна среда, в която искате да покажете продукт с определен набор от данни. С EaaS можете да го постигнете за няколко минути.
Продажбите ще се увеличат по-бързо и маркетинговият обхват ще бъде разширен.
R&D среда
Фантастично допълнение към стойността позволява на вашите разработчици свободата да бъдат иновативни и да изпробват нови концепции.
Вашите разработчици просто ще трябва да щракнат веднъж с помощта на EaaS, за да отворят пясъчник, за да могат да експериментират и да тестват нови идеи, без да се притесняват за настройването на всички параметри.
Как EaaS влияе на DevOps?
Бизнес гъвкавостта и потоците от приходи се движат от приложенията. Тежестта на създаването на среди за приложения за техните екипи, за да се улесни бързото разработване, тестване и внедряване, пада върху предприятията, фокусирани върху DevOps, които участват в тази цифрова трансформация.
За съжаление, създаването и разпространението на среди за приложения, които вашите екипи искат, отнема много усилия и е скъпо поради скрити разходи и трудности при мащабиране.
В резултат на това бяха необходими среди като сервизни решения за мащабиране на DevOps процедурите.
(EaaS) решенията помагат на клиентите да дефинират приложения заедно с необходимата им инфраструктура и данни, правейки ги мобилни и достъпни, така че да могат да се използват без прекъсване от който и да е процес.
Целта на EaaS е да ускори иновациите в мащаб, като се отърве от пречките в средата на приложението.
Трите начина за мащабиране на DevOps с помощта на средата като услуга са изброени по-долу.
Спечелете предпочитание за облак
Бизнесът сега оцелява благодарение на гъвкавостта на своите приложения на пазар, който се развива бързо.
Капацитетът на компанията да се възползва напълно от облака обаче е ограничен от ефектите от блокирането на облака и притеснението от загуба на контрол върху данните и инфраструктурата на приложението, което може да окаже влияние върху приходите, производителността и времето за пускане на пазара.
За да приложите мулти-облачна стратегия за вашето DevOps начинание, можете да използвате решенията за среда като услуга, за да изградите един общ план, който може да се използва за извикване на всеки от вашите налични облачни ресурси, включително AWS, Azure или Kubernetes.
Автоматизирайте вашата среда.
Осигуряването на вашите екипи за разработка, тестване и производство на сложните среди, от които се нуждаят, за да изпълняват задълженията си и да напредват в програмата, се превърна в нов проблем с появата на подходи за гъвкаво развитие и DevOps.
Средите за тестване и разработка, които имат по-кратък срок на годност от производствените настройки, не наследяват непременно сигурността и степента на сложност, които са разработени във вашата производствена среда.
Вероятността за разкриване на уязвимости, свързани с производството, се увеличава със степента на отклонение от производствената среда.
Вашите отдалечени екипи могат да имат способността за самообслужване да задействат и извеждат от експлоатация средите при поискване чрез използване на решение за среда като услуга за създаване на стандартна, автоматизирана среда. Това може да ускори времето за пускане на пазара.
Контролирайте екологичното потребление
Когато трябва да мащабирате, облачните доставчици, улеснете добавянето на допълнителни облачни ресурси. Ефективното управление на вашите среди обаче е предизвикателство поради липсата на представа за използването на ресурси, разходите за облак и други фактори.
Можете да получите важните знания, които искате, за да управлявате потреблението на околната среда, да ограничите разрастването на облака и да се подготвите прецизно за бъдещи нужди от ресурси с помощта на Environment
Заключение
За да работи вашата компания възможно най-бързо, без да прави компромис с качеството, EaaS е от съществено значение. Можете да увеличите времето за работа на вашето приложение и да предоставите надеждни услуги с по-кратки цикли на издаване, като използвате EaaS.
Това не само ви помага да спестите пари и изключително важно време, но също така значително повишава калибъра на крайния ви резултат. Използването на EaaS ще промени вътрешните среди за тестване и ще увеличи производителността на DevOps.
Оставете коментар